About Handelex

Overview

Handelex is a retail forex and CFD broker established on 25 June 2023 and registered in the United Kingdom. The company operates through its official website, handelex.com, and targets individual traders with a range of account tiers featuring high leverage limits. As of the time of this review, Handelex does not hold any licences from recognised regulatory authorities, which is a significant factor for traders to consider.

Regulation and Safety

FXCanary’s records indicate that Handelex has no regulators on file. The broker is registered in the United Kingdom, but UK registration as a business does not equate to financial regulation. Without authorisation from bodies such as the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) or equivalent, traders do not benefit from investor protection schemes, compensation funds, or oversight of the broker’s operations. The absence of regulation is a key risk factor.

Account Types and Leverage

Handelex offers four account types tailored to different deposit levels. The Basic account starts at €250 with leverage up to 1:100, while the Silver account requires €10,000 and provides up to 1:200 leverage. The Gold account starts at €25,000 with leverage up to 1:300, and the Platinum account requires €100,000 with leverage up to 1:400. These high leverage ratios, especially on higher tiers, can amplify both gains and losses, making them suitable only for experienced traders with substantial capital.

Company Background

Founded in mid-2023, Handelex is a relatively new entrant to the online brokerage space. Its UK registration provides no guarantee of financial oversight. The broker’s website is live and functional, with login and registration portals, but limited publicly available information beyond marketing claims. The combination of a short operational history and no regulation raises cautionary flags for traders seeking a trusted counterparty.
